I love this song. the fusion of retro and orchestral instruments is really nice. I like that this theme manages to be dramatic and emotional without sounding sappy or clichéd. along with that, it feels thematically fitting for asgore's character and works pretty well as a final boss theme.
on the topic of the remix, I used a lot of zunpets for this remix (I think it was five?). they felt fitting for asgore's theme, tho I may have gone a little overboard in a few places. for the bergentrückung/intro part, I used a majestic trumpet, an elegant piano, and a playful marimba to represent each of the three Dremurrs. you could probably guess which instruments symbolize who.
